Peter Royen

Peter Royen is a Dutch and German painter, graphic artist and sculptor, member of the Malkasten Association of Artists.

Peter Royen is widely known for his white silent paintings, for which he has been called the "artist of silence". Royen endlessly experimented with his beloved white, layering and layering it in different variations, combining it with other colors. Right angles, squares, rectangles, stripes feel comfortable in white, sometimes they are lost in it or even dissolve.
